About North Region
The North Region is responsible for the maintenance and repair of 4,344 lane miles of state highways and freeways in the northern 21 counties of the Lower Peninsula. In addition to the region office, North Region has three transportation service centers, three operations facilities, two testing labs, a region sign shop, and one welcome center.
Regions and TSCs work with local governments, elected officials, stakeholders, and residents to ensure positive transportation decisions that keep people and goods moving safely, efficiently, and reliably through the region.
Counties: Alcona, Alpena, Antrim, Benzie, Charlevoix, Cheboygan, Crawford, Emmet, Grand Traverse, Iosco, Kalkaska, Leelanau, Manistee, Missaukee, Montmorency, Oscoda, Ogemaw, Otsego, Presque Isle, Roscommon, and Wexford
